Purposes

Reconstruction of the right inferior hepatic vein (RIHV) presents a major technical challenge in living donor liver transplantation (LDLT) using right lobe grafts.

Methods

We studied 47 right lobe LDLT grafts with RIHV revascularization, comparing one-step reconstruction, performed post-May 2007 (n = 16), with direct anastomosis, performed pre-May 2007 (n = 31).

Results

In the one-step reconstruction technique, the internal jugular vein (n = 6), explanted portal vein (n = 5), inferior vena cava (n = 3), and shunt vessels (n = 2) were used as venous patch grafts for unifying the right hepatic vein, RIHVs, and middle hepatic vein tributaries. By 6 months after LDLT, there was no case of occlusion of the reconstructed RIHVs in the one-step reconstruction group, but a cumulative occlusion rate of 18.2 % in the direct anastomosis group. One-step reconstruction required a longer cold ischemic time (182 ± 40 vs. 115 ± 63, p < 0.001) and these patients had higher alanine transaminase values (142 ± 79 vs. 96 ± 46 IU/L, p = 0.024) on postoperative day POD 7. However, the 6-month short-term graft survival rates were 100 % with one-step reconstruction and 83.9 % with direct anastomosis, respectively.

Conclusion

One-step reconstruction of the RIHVs using auto-venous grafts is an easy and feasible technique promoting successful right lobe LDLT.  相似文献

Background

Although various complications after hepatectomy have been reported, there have been no large studies on postoperative portal vein thrombosis (PVT) as a complication. This study evaluated the incidence, risk factors, and clinical outcomes of PVT after hepatectomy.

Methods

The preoperative and postoperative clinical characteristics of patients who underwent hepatectomy were retrospectively analyzed.

Results

A total of 208 patients were reviewed. The incidence of PVT after hepatectomy was 9.1 % (n = 19), including main portal vein (MPV) thrombosis (n = 7) and peripheral portal vein (PPV) thrombosis (n = 12). Patients with MPV thrombosis had a significantly higher incidence of right hepatectomy (p < 0.001), larger resection volume (p = 0.003), and longer operation time (p = 0.021) than patients without PVT (n = 189). Multivariate analysis identified right hepatectomy as a significant independent risk factor for MPV thrombosis (odds ratio 108.9; p < 0.001). Patients with PPV thrombosis had a significantly longer duration of Pringle maneuver than patients without PVT (p = 0.002). Among patients who underwent right hepatectomy, those with PVT (n = 6) had a significantly lower early liver regeneration rate than those without PVT (n = 13; p = 0.040), and those with PVT had deterioration of liver function on postoperative day 7. In all patients with MPV thrombosis who received anticoagulation therapy, PVT subsequently resolved.

Conclusions

Postoperative PVT after hepatectomy is not rare. It is closely related to delayed recovery of liver function and delayed liver regeneration.  相似文献

Purpose

The feasibility of performing living donor liver transplantation (LDLT) for patients with high end-stage liver disease (MELD) scores needs to be assessed.

Methods

A total of 357 patients who underwent LDLT were included in this analysis.

Results

Overall, 46 patients had high MELD scores (≥25) and their graft survival was similar to that in patients with low MELD scores (<25; n = 311; p = 0.395). However, among patients with high MELD scores, a multivariate analysis showed that the presence of hepatitis C (p = 0.013) and LDLT in Era-I (p = 0.036) was significantly associated with a poorer prognosis. Among patients with hepatitis C (n = 155), the 5-year graft survival rate was significantly lower in patients with high MELD scores (33.7 %, p < 0.001) than in patients with low MELD scores. The 5-year graft survival rate was significantly lower in patients in Era-I (n = 119) compared with those in Era-II/III when stratified by low (73.0 vs. 82.5 %, p = 0.040) and high (55.0 vs. 86.1 %, p = 0.023) MELD scores. Among the patients with high MELD scores, those with hepatitis C and LDLT in Era-I had the worst 5-year graft survival rate (14.3, p < 0.001).

Conclusion

The graft outcomes in patients with high MELD scores and the presence of hepatitis C were found to be particularly poor.  相似文献

Background and aims

Whey protein, a protein complex derived from milk is well known as a functional food with a number of health benefits. MEIN® (Meiji Dairies Co., Tokyo Japan) is a functional liquid-type nutritional diet containing whey-hydrolyzed peptide. In this study, we examined the effects of MEIN® on postoperative liver dysfunction in patients who underwent living donor-related liver transplantation (LDLT).

Methods

Sixteen adult patients transplanted between 2005 and 2011 at our institute were evaluated retrospectively. In MEIN group (n = 8), administration of MEIN® was started around 14 days after liver transplantation when serum liver enzymes were re-elevated, while MEIN® was not administered in the control group (n = 8) who did not have postoperative liver dysfunction.

Results

In the preoperative clinical characteristics, the model for end-stage liver disease score in the MEIN group was significantly lower than that in the control group. The graft-to-recipient body weight ratio in the MEIN group was lower than that in the control group. Elevation of enzymes in the liver function tests such as alanine aminotransferase and total bilirubin, and C-reactive protein in the MEIN group had significantly improved, and became almost normal values which were the same as those in the control group.

Conclusion

These findings suggest that administration of whey-hydrolyzed peptide attenuates the post-transplant liver dysfunction and may avoid an unnecessary liver biopsy.  相似文献

Background

The American Joint Committee on Cancer (AJCC) has recommended that cancers with liver involvement be graded T2b and those with portal vein involvement be graded T3, although the value of staging as prognostic factors remains unclear. We evaluated the current definition of the T2/3 tumors for perihilar cholangiocarcinoma.

Methods

A total of 202 patients with perihilar cholangiocarcinoma who underwent hepatectomy without vascular resection were enrolled. Clinicopathologic data about invasion of the liver and the unilateral portal vein were evaluated.

Results

The liver and the unilateral portal vein were involved in 100 (49.5 %) and 38 (18.8 %) patients, respectively. The survival rates were not significantly different between patients with and without liver invasion (48.6 vs. 52.2 %, respectively, at 5 years, P = 0.157) and between patients with or without unilateral portal vein invasion (43.2 vs. 52.1 %, respectively, at 5 years, P = 0.363). The survival rate of patients with tumors staged pT2b was not significantly different from the rate of patients with pT2a (63.4 vs. 55.6 % at 5 years, P = 0.912), and the pT2b tumor patient survival rate was better than the rate of patients with pT3 (34.9 % at 5 years, P = 0.011). Using multivariate analysis, nodal metastasis (P = 0.003), positive surgical margin (P = 0.010), and Bismuth type IV tumor (P = 0.039) were identified as independent prognostic factors.

Conclusions

The liver and the unilateral portal vein are frequently involved in perihilar cholangiocarcinoma. The determinants of the current AJCC T2/3 tumor classifications are rational; however, subdivision of T2 tumors may be of less clinical value.  相似文献

Introduction

In patients with advanced cirrhosis, stressful stimuli may reveal a silent reduced cardiac performance. During liver transplantation (LT), graft reperfusion strongly stresses the heart and may unmask latent myocardial dysfunction.

Aim

The objective of this study was to assess heart response to acutely increased preload after liver graft reperfusion and correlate this response with preoperative data and outcome.

Methods

Preoperative clinical, echocardiographic, and hemodynamic data, and patient outcome were retrospectively recorded for 235 liver recipients who had no known cardiac disease. Myocardial dysfunction was defined as less than 10 % increase of stroke volume after graft reperfusion (non-responder).

Results

We found 84 (35.7 %) non-responder patients. The non-responders showed higher Model for end-stage liver disease scores (p = 0.046), left atrial diameter (LAD) (p = 0.040), hepatic vein pressure gradient (p = 0.055), and hyperdynamic state than responders. The percentages of patients with hyponatremia (p = 0.048) and alcohol etiology (p = 0.025) were also higher among non-responders. Independent predictors of inadequate cardiac response in the multivariate analysis were low preoperative systemic vascular resistance (SVRI) [odds ratio (OR) 3.09, 95 % CI 1.15–4.82; p = 0.027] and enlargement of LAD (OR 2.08, 95 % CI 1.49–2.74; p = 0.044). Non-response was associated with higher rates of early cardiovascular events [hazard ratio (HR) 2.84, 95 % CI 1.09–4.22; p = 0.039] and higher length of intensive care unit stay (p = 0.038). No differences were found in 1-year survival rates.

Conclusions

Latent cardiac dysfunction among LT recipients, considered to be abnormal stroke volume response to unclamping of portal vein, is very prevalent. SVRI and LAD were independent predictors of inadequate responses. This condition deserves special attention since it may aggravate the early postoperative course of LT.  相似文献

Purpose

This study was designed to analyze the clinical outcomes of the recurrence of hepatocellular carcinoma (HCC) after living donor liver transplantation (LDLT) and to evaluate the efficacy of a surgical resection in treating such a recurrence.

Methods

A total of 101 adult LDLT recipients with HCC between 1996 and 2007, including 17 who had recurrent HCC, were reviewed. The endpoints analyzed were survival from time of transplant and survival from time of recurrence. Recipient demographics, laboratory valuables, and tumor characteristics were analyzed. Any medical or surgical treatments that had been administered for any recurrence also were considered.

Results

The mean duration until the initial recurrence after LDLT and the mean duration until death after the initial recurrence were 12.9 months and 12.0 months, respectively. A univariate analysis showed that gender, interferon therapy, early posttransplant tumor recurrence, and eligibility for a surgical resection all had a beneficial impact on survival from tumor recurrence. A surgical resection of tumor relapse was the most important variable in our study, and therefore the patients were divided into two groups: surgical therapy group (n = 9), and nonsurgical therapy group (n = 7). Interestingly, the overall survival rates of the surgical group were significantly better than those of the nonsurgical group and were similar to that of the patients without HCC recurrence.

Conclusions

Surgical therapy might be useful for patients who experience a recurrence of HCC after LDLT to improve their outcome, when such treatment is available.  相似文献

Purpose

To evaluate the safety and efficacy of sequential transcatheter arterial chemoembolization (TACE) and portal vein embolization (PVE) prior to surgery in hepatocellular carcinoma (HCC) patients and to compare the clinical outcome of the combined procedure with that of a matched group of patients undergoing PVE alone.

Patients and Methods

From 1997 to 2008, 135 patients with HCC underwent sequential TACE and PVE (n = 71) or PVE alone (n = 64) before right hepatectomy. PVE was performed mean 1.2 months after TACE. In both groups, computed tomography (CT) and liver volumetry were performed before and 2 weeks after PVE to assess degree of left lobe hypertrophy.

Results

Baseline patient and tumor characteristics were similar in the two groups. After PVE, the chronological changes of liver enzymes were similar in the two groups. The mean increase in percentage future liver remnant (FLR) volume was higher in the TACE + PVE group (7.3%) than in the PVE-only group (5.8%) (P = 0.035). After surgery, incidence of hepatic failure was higher in the PVE-only group (12%) than in the TACE + PVE (4%) group (P = 0.185). Overall (P = 0.028) and recurrence-free (P = 0.001) survival rates were significantly higher in the TACE + PVE group than in the PVE-only group.

Conclusion

Sequential TACE and PVE before surgery is a safe and effective method to increase the rate of hypertrophy of the FLR and leads to longer overall and recurrence-free survival in patients with HCC.  相似文献

Background

In partial liver transplantation, reconstruction of the hepatic artery is technically highly demanding and the incidence of arterial complications is high. We attempted to identify the risk factors for anastomotic complications after hepatic artery reconstruction and examined the role of multidetector-row computed tomography (MDCT) in the evaluation of the reconstructed hepatic artery in liver transplant recipients.

Methods

A total of 109 adult-to-adult living donor liver transplantations (LDLT) were performed at our institute between 1999 and July 2011. Hepatic artery reconstruction was performed under a surgical microscope (MS group, n = 84), until we began to adopt surgical loupes (4.5×) for arterial reconstructions in all cases after January 2009 (SL group, n = 25). A dynamic MDCT study was prospectively carried out on postoperative days 7, 14, and 28, and at postoperative month 3, 6, and 12 after April 2005 (n = 60).

Results

There were no cases of hepatic artery thrombosis and six cases (5.5 %) of interventional radiology-confirmed hepatic artery stenosis (HAS). Risk factor analysis for HAS showed that ABO-incompatible LDLT was associated with HAS. Use of surgical loupes provided superior results as compared to anastomosis under a surgical microscope, and it also provided the advantage of reduced operative time. The MDCT procedure was useful for detecting HAS; however, the false positive rate was relatively high until 3 months after the LDLT (100 % sensitivity and 72.8 % specificity at 3 months).

Conclusions

Hepatic arterial anastomosis using surgical loupes tended to be time-saving and to yield similar or better results than traditional microscope-anastomosis. The use of MDCT aided the diagnosis of HAS, although the substantial false positive rate should be borne in mind in clinical practice.  相似文献

Background

Laparoscopic splenectomy (LS) is significantly more challenging in patients with supramassive splenomegaly and those with portal hypertension. We hypothesized that hand-assisted laparoscopic splenectomy (HALS) could facilitate the procedure in these patients.

Methods

Before October 2009, patients with supramassive splenomegaly and those with portal hypertension underwent LS. After October 2009, we routinely applied HALS in patients with these disorders.

Results

We compared the HALS group (n = 41) with the LS group (n = 45). There were no conversions to open surgery in the HALS group, whereas there was an 4.5 % conversion rate in the LS group. The operating times were shorter, and there was less estimated blood loss, and fewer major complications in the HALS group. Analgesia requirement, time to full diet, and postoperative stay were comparable in the two groups.

Conclusions

We concluded that HALS was superior to LS in patients with supramassive splenomegaly and in those with portal hypertension.  相似文献

Background

Portal vein occlusion to increase the size of the future liver remnant (FLR) is well established, using portal vein ligation (PVL) or embolization (PVE) followed by resection 4–8 weeks later. Associating liver partition with portal vein ligation for staged hepatectomy (ALPPS) combines PVL and complete parenchymal transection, followed by hepatectomy within 1–2 weeks. ALPPS has been recently introduced but remains controversial. We compare the ability of ALPPS versus PVE or PVL for complete tumor resection.

Methods

A retrospective review of all patients undergoing ALPPS or conventional staged hepatectomies using PVL or PVE at four high-volume HPB centres between 2003 and 2012 was performed. Patients with primary liver tumors and liver metastases were included. Primary endpoint was complete tumor resection. Secondary endpoints include 90-day mortality, complications, FLR increase, time to resection, and tumor recurrence.

Results

Forty-eight patients with ALPPS were compared with 83 patients with conventional-staged hepatectomies. Eighty-three percent (40/48 patients) of ALPPS patients achieved complete resection compared with 66 % (55/83 patients) in PVE/PVL (odds ratio 3.34, p = 0.027). Ninety-day mortality in ALPPS and PVE/PVL was 15 and 6 %, respectively (p = 0.2). Extrapolated growth rate was 11 times higher in ALPPS (34.8 cc/day; interquartile range (IQR) 26–49) compared with PVE/PVL (3 cc/day; IQR2-6; p = 0.001). Tumor recurrence at 1 year was 54 versus 52 % for ALPPS and PVE/PVL, respectively (p = 0.7).

Conclusions

This study provides evidence that ALPPS offers a better chance of complete resection in patients with primarily unresectable liver tumors at the cost of a high mortality. The technique is promising but should currently not be used outside of studies and registries.  相似文献

Objectives

In adults undergoing living donor liver transplantation (LDLT), the transplanted livers are partial grafts, and the portal venous pressure is higher than that observed with whole liver grafts. In patients undergoing LDLT concomitant with splenomegaly, portal venous flow is often diverted to collateral vessels, leading to a high risk of portal vein thrombosis. In such cases, occlusion of the collateral veins is important; however, complete occlusion of all collaterals without blocking the blood flow through the splenic artery causes portal hypertension and liver failure. We aimed to examine the effect of performing a splenectomy concomitant with LDLT to reduce portal vein complications.

Methods

Between 1991 and 2017, we performed 170 LDLT operations, including 83 in adults. For this cohort study, adult cases were divided into 2 groups. Group I was those who underwent LDLT without splenectomy (n = 60); Group II was those who underwent LDLT with splenectomy for the reduction of portal hypertension (n = 23). We investigated the incident rates of complications, including blood loss, lethal portal vein thrombosis (intrahepatic thrombosis), acute rejection, and so on. We also investigated the survival rates in both groups.

Results

The incident rate of lethal portal vein thrombosis in Group II was significantly lower than that observed in Group I (4.4% vs 21.7%, respectively, P = .0363). There were no statistically significant differences observed between the groups with respect to blood loss, survival rates, and other such parameters.

Conclusion

LDLT concomitant with splenectomy might effectively reduce the occurrence of portal vein complications in adults.  相似文献

Background

In patients with Bismuth type I and II hilar cholangiocarcinoma (HCCA), bile duct resection alone has been the conventional approach. However, many authors have reported that concomitant liver resection improved surgical outcomes.

Methods

Between January 2000 and January 2012, 52 patients underwent surgical resection for a Bismuth type I and II HCCA (type I: n = 22; type II: n = 30). Patients were classified into two groups: concomitant liver resection (n = 26) and bile duct resection alone (n = 26).

Results

Bile duct resection alone was performed in 26 patients. Concomitant liver resection was performed in 26 patients (right side hepatectomy [n = 13]; left-side hepatectomy [n = 6]; volume-preserving liver resection [n = 7]). All liver resections included a caudate lobectomy. Patient and tumor characteristics did not differ between the two groups. Although concomitant liver resection required longer operating time (P < 0.001), it had a similar postoperative complication rate (P = 0.764), high curability (P = 0.010), and low local recurrence rate (P = 0.006). Concomitant liver resection showed better overall survival (P = 0.047).

Conclusions

Concomitant liver resection should be considered in patients with Bismuth type I and II HCCA.  相似文献

Background

The aim of this study was to compare the results of surgical resection with three-dimensional conformal radiotherapy (3D-CRT) in the treatment of resectable hepatocellular carcinoma (HCC) with portal vein tumor thrombus (PVTT). Transarterial chemoembolization (TACE) was given to both groups of patients when possible.

Methods

A retrospective study of 371 patients with resectable HCC with PVTT was conducted in two tertiary referral centers. The treatment of choice for these patients in one center was surgical resection. In the other center it was 3D-CRT. In the radiotherapy group (RG, n = 185), patients received 3D-CRT to the tumor and PVTT for a total radiation dose of 30–52 Gy (median 40 Gy). In the surgical group (SG, n = 186), patients underwent surgical resection. TACE was applied after surgery or 3D-CRT and then was repeated every 4–6 weeks if the patient tolerated the treatment.

Results

The median survival was 12.3 months for RG and 10.0 months for SG. The 1-, 2-, and 3-year overall survivals were 51.6, 28.4, and 19.9 %, respectively, for RG and 40.1, 17.0, and 13.6 %, respectively, for SG (p = 0.029). Stepwise multivariate analysis showed that the extent of PVTT and mode of treatment were independent risk factors of overall survival. The most common cause of death after treatment was liver failure as a consequence of progressive intrahepatic disease.

Conclusions

3D-CRT gave better survival than surgical resection for HCC with PVTT.  相似文献

Purpose

We measured the slope gradients (SGs) of the vascular time–intensity curves (TICs) of the intrahepatic vessels on contrast-enhanced ultrasonography (CEUS). The aim of this study was to assess the diagnostic accuracy of the SG of each hepatic vessel, particularly the portal vein (PV), for detecting cirrhosis and to compare this method with conventional modalities.

Methods

Fifty-one preoperative patients underwent CEUS, and the TICs were plotted. The SGs of the hepatic artery, PV and hepatic vein were obtained from the linear functions between the slope of the arrival time of the contrast agent and the peak enhancement time of each vessel. The transit times and levels of biochemical markers were also measured. The patients were divided into three groups according to the Metavir score: F0/1 group (n = 14), F2/3 group (n = 21) and F4 group (n = 16).

Results

The PVSG significantly decreased in the F4 group (F0/1: 29.1 ± 2.27, F2/3: 23.1 ± 1.86, F4: 14.7 ± 2.13). The PVSG demonstrated high accuracy for diagnosing cirrhosis and was correlated with the levels of ICG-R15 and hyaluronic acid (Spearman rank correlation; ρ = ?0.5691, p < 0.001 and ρ = ?0.4652, p = 0.0006).

Conclusions

The PVSG has the potential to be a diagnostic marker for identifying patients with well-compensated cirrhosis.  相似文献

Background

Inadequate hemostasis during living donor liver transplantation (LDLT) is mainly due to coagulopathy but may also include fibrinolysis. The purpose of this study was to determine the incidence of fibrinolysis and assess its relevance to mortality in LDLT.

Methods

The incidence and prognosis of fibrinolysis were retrospectively studied in 76 patients who underwent LDLT between April 2010 and February 2013. Fibrinolysis was evaluated and defined by maximum lysis (ML) >15% within a 60-minute run time using thromboelastometry (ROTEM).

Results

Fibrinolysis was observed in 19 of the 76 (25%) patients before the anhepatic (pre-anhepatic) phase and was developed in 24 (32%) patients during and after the anhepatic (post-anhepatic) phase. In these 43 patients who had fibrinolysis, spontaneous recovery occurred in 29 patients (73%) within 3 hours after reperfusion of the liver graft. Recovery with tranexamic acid was noted in 2 patients with fibrinolysis in the post-anhepatic phase. Thrombosis in the portal vein and liver artery was noted in 14 patients, and the incidence was significantly greater in patients with post-anhepatic fibrinolysis than in those with pre-anhepatic fibrinolysis (P = .0017). Fibrinolysis that developed in the pre-anhepatic phase was associated with increased 30-day and 6-month mortalities (P = .0003 and .0026, respectively).

Conclusions

Fibrinolysis existed and developed in a large percentage of patients during LDLT. Thrombosis in the portal vein and hepatic artery was more common in patients with fibrinolysis in the post-anhepatic phase. Fibrinolysis that developed in the pre-anhepatic phase was associated with increased 30-day and 6-month mortalities.  相似文献

Background

Hepatic inflow clamping during hepatectomy introduces ischemia–reperfusion (I/R) injury, and many authors regard the addition of caval occlusion as adding increased risk. Ischemic preconditioning (IPC) is one of the protective strategies employed to reduce I/R injury in animal experiments and limited clinical series. The aim of the present study was to determine the impact of systematic adoption of IPC in patients undergoing complex hepatectomy under total hepatic vascular exclusion (TVE) based on outcomes review.

Methods

The records of 93 patients who underwent major hepatectomy involving TVE at our center from February 1998 to December 2008 were reviewed. These patients were divided into two groups: group 1 (n = 55, TVE alone) and group 2 (n = 38, TVE with IPC). IPC was performed by portal triad clamping for 10 min followed by 3–5 min of reperfusion prior to TVE and resection.

Results

The two groups were comparable regarding demographics, underlying liver diseases, indications for hepatectomy, duration of TVE, and preoperative liver and kidney function tests. Overall postoperative laboratory results of liver function tests were not significantly different between the two groups. Creatinine levels and prothrombin times were not significantly different between the groups. The use of IPC had no impact on the duration of the operation, blood loss, or hospital stay. The morbidity rates were 37.5 and 34.2 %, respectively.

Conclusions

Our adoption of IPC as a protective strategy against I/R injury under TVE did not affect operative or laboratory parameters and clinical outcomes when compared to continuous clamping for comparable ischemic periods.  相似文献

Background

Although portal vein embolization (PVE) has been applied for surgical resection of colorectal liver metastases (CLM), the clinical usefulness of liver surgery following PVE for CLM remains unknown.

Methods

A total of 115 patients were evaluated retrospectively. Among them, 49 underwent one-stage hepatectomy following PVE (PVE group). The remaining 66 patients underwent at least hemihepatectomy without PVE (non-PVE group). This analysis compared the short- and long-term outcomes between the PVE and non-PVE groups.

Results

There were no deaths in either group. Using the Clavien–Dindo classification, the rates of postoperative morbidity ≥ grade 1 were 34.7 % in the PVE group and 25.0 % in the non-PVE group (p = 0.26). The 3-year overall survival rates were 54.6 and 64.5 % in the PVE and non-PVE groups, respectively (p = 0.89). The multivariate analysis the variable performance/nonperformance of PVE was not detected as an independent predictor of poor survival.

Conclusions

Our one-stage hepatectomy policy of using PVE provides acceptable morbidity and favorable long-term outcomes.  相似文献

Purposes

Pancreatic cancer still has a poor prognosis even after curative resection because of the high incidence of postoperative liver metastasis. This study prospectively evaluated the feasibility and tolerability of portal vein infusion chemotherapy of gemcitabine (PVIG) as an adjuvant setting after pancreatic resection.

Methods

Thirteen patients enrolled in this study received postoperative chemotherapy with PVIG. The patients received intermittent administration of gemcitabine (800 mg/m2) via the portal vein on days 1, 8, and 15 after surgery. The tolerability and the toxicity of PVIG were closely monitored.

Results

The PVIG was started on an average of 3.1 days after surgery. Complete doses of chemotherapy (three sessions of portal infusion) were accomplished in 11 of the 13 patients. Grade 3 or 4 leukocytopenia was observed in three patients (23 %), and liver dysfunction was found in one patient (7.7 %). Grade 2 sepsis developed in two cases due to bloodstream infection. Liver metastasis was the first site of recurrence in only two patients.

Conclusions

PVIG can be administered to the liver with acceptable toxicity, but myelosuppression is similar to the systemic use of gemcitabine. Careful observation is required even for locoregional chemotherapy.  相似文献

Background

After receiving a living donor liver transplant (LDLT), an incisional hernia is a potentially serious complication that can affect the patient’s quality of life. In the present study we evaluated surgical hernia repair after LDLT.

Materials and methods

Medical records of patients who underwent surgery to repair an incisional hernia after LDLT in Turgut Ozal Medical Center between October 2006 and January 2010 were evaluated in this retrospective study. A reverse-T incision was made for liver transplantation. The hernias were repaired with onlay polypropylene mesh. Age, gender, post-transplant relaparatomy, the type, the result of surgery for the incisional hernia, and risk factors for developing incisional hernia were evaluated.

Results

An incisional hernia developed in 44 of 173 (25.4 %) patients after LDLT. Incisional hernia repair was performed in 14 of 173 patients (8.1 %) who underwent LDLT from October 2006 to January 2010. Relaparatomy was associated with incisional hernia (p = 0.0002). The mean age at the time of the incisional hernia repair was 51 years, and 79 % of the patients were men. The median follow-up period was 19.2 (13–36) months after the hernia repair. Three patients with intestinal incarceration underwent emergency surgery to repair the hernia. Partial small bowel resection was required in one patient. Postoperative complications included seroma formation in one patient and wound infection in another. There was no recurrence of hernia during the follow-up period.

Conclusions

The incidence of incisional hernia after LDLT was 25.4 % in this study. Relaparatomy increases the probability of developing incisional hernia in recipients of LDLT. According to the results of the study, repair of an incisional hernia with onlay mesh is a suitable option.  相似文献
